Dasanee, 10, loves outdoors

-

Dasanee is an athletic 10-year-old girl of African-American descent. She can be quiet when you meet her, but once she feels comfortabl­e, she warms up and is friendly. Dasanee has good manners and likes to be helpful. Some of her favorite activities include listening to music, singing, dancing, swimming and going to the local arcade. She also loves to spend time outside. Dasanee is currently a fourth-grade student and is involved in chorus and intramural sports. She also plays the trumpet.

Dasanee is legally free for adoption and ready to find her forever family. She would benefit from living in a two-parent household where the parents provide structure and clear expectatio­ns. Dasanee hopes her future family will have pets and other children in the home. An active family would be ideal as Dasanee enjoys getting out of the house frequently. Any interested family should be open to maintainin­g Dasanee’s connection­s with her brother, aunt and cousin, whom she visits regularly.

Who can adopt?

Can you provide the guidance, love and stability that a child needs? If you’re at least 18 years old, have a stable source of income and room in your heart, you may be a perfect match to adopt a waiting child. Adoptive parents can be single, married or partnered; experience­d or not; renters or homeowners; LGBTQ singles and couples.

The process to adopt a child from foster care requires training, interviews and home visits to determine if adoption is right for you, and if so, to help connect you with a child or sibling group that your family will be a good match for.
